Study on father-daughter children of Binghamton University (New York - USA)
According to research by experts from Binghamton University (New York, USA), children born with looks like their father tend to be healthier when they turn 1 year old .
It is true that in fact, the fact that the facial contours of a baby have no effect on their health. However, from a psychological point of view, and as hypothesized by researchers, when a child resembles a father, the probability of a father spending more time with his child is higher. And as a matter of fact, when a child receives enough love from both the mother and the father, this brings a lot of benefits.
"The father's contribution is very important in raising children, and it shows in the health of the baby" - said study author Solomon Polachek from Binghamton University.
Subject of the study of the father offspring
456 families have participated in the study called Fragile Families and Child Wellbeing - FFCW (roughly translated: Families are fragile and child welfare). And this study focuses mainly on:
These families are not married
Or broke up.
Next, experts evaluate the health of children at their first birthday according to several factors, including:
Time in hospital
Frequency of examination
Or frequency of attacks of difficulty breathing
And other factors
Of course, these factors are not really accurate. Because there are circumstances such as financial factors and time is also a barrier to bringing the baby to the doctor when the baby is sick. However, in terms of statistics, it still shows a certain trend.
Research results
Research shows that, on average, fathers spend 2.5 days a month more than usual to play with their children, if the child looks like him.
Through the subjects of the family participating in the study, it also partly tells a situation about single families in the US. Currently, the data shows that such types of families are on the rise, and in doing so make the children suffer a lot.
"We need more effort to encourage fathers to be actively involved in child care, perhaps by taking them to parenting classes, prenatal health education ..." - Polachek said.
